Placement Your Humidifier for Maximum Benefit

To get the most out of your humidifier, keep in mind its spot.

Generally, it's best to put it in a main area where air can circulate easily. Avoid placing it in storage areas as this can reduce airflow.

A good rule of thumb is to position your humidifier at least 2 feet away from any walls. This will help ensure that the humidified air is shared evenly throughout the room.

Additionally, remember to steer clear of placing your humidifier near heat sources, as this can dehydrate the air fast.

Sleep Soundly: How Close Should a Humidifier Be to Your Bed?

When it comes to getting a quality slumber, a humidifier can be a valuable tool. It where to put humidifier adds moisture to the air, which can reduce nighttime dryness. However, placement matters! Too close to your bed, and you might experience dampness. Too far away, and it won't effectively add moisture. A good rule of thumb is to keep your humidifier around 3-5 feet from your bed. This creates a comfortable humidity level without being too invasive.

Balancing Air Vapor : Strategic Humidifier Placement Tips

Achieving the ideal humidity level in your home is crucial for comfort. A well-placed humidifier can significantly boost air quality and make your living space more pleasant. To optimize its effectiveness, consider these strategic placement tips:

  • Avoid placing your humidifier in a corner as this can contain moisture and create an uneven humidity distribution.
  • Locate your humidifier in a strategically located area to ensure even humidity throughout the room.
  • Keep your humidifier at least a few feet away from windows to prevent moisture buildup and potential mold growth.
  • Position on a stand your humidifier slightly off the ground to promote airflow and humidity circulation.
  • Consider using a humidistat to automatically regulate the humidity level in your space.

By following these tips, you can guarantee optimal humidity levels and create a more pleasant living environment.

Boosting Comfort: Guide to Proper Humidifier Positioning

To maximize the benefits of your humidifier and ensure optimal comfort, it's crucial to position it correctly within your space. Consider placing your humidifier on a sturdy, flat surface, away from direct drafts or sources of heat. Avoid positioning it near flammable materials or in areas with high foot traffic. Experiment with different locations to determine the ideal spot for distributing moisture evenly throughout the room. You may want to elevate your humidifier slightly on a shelf or stand to improve air circulation and prevent water from splashing onto surrounding surfaces. Remember, proper positioning can significantly enhance the effectiveness of your humidifier and contribute to a more comfortable and healthy indoor environment.

  • Avoid placing your humidifier directly under vents or ceiling fans as this can alter airflow patterns.
  • Ensure that the humidifier's water tank is regularly cleaned and filled with fresh water to prevent mineral buildup and maintain optimal performance.
  • If you have pets, consider placing the humidifier in an area obtainable only to humans to prevent them from knocking it over.
